Things To Do
in Andradina
Andradina is a vibrant city located in the state of São Paulo, Brazil, known for its rich agricultural background and welcoming community. Nestled near the Paraná River, it boasts beautiful landscapes and a warm climate, making it an attractive destination for nature lovers. The city offers a variety of cultural attractions, including local festivals and traditional cuisine that reflect the region's heritage.
With its friendly atmosphere and numerous recreational opportunities, Andradina is an excellent spot for both relaxation and adventure.

How to Behave
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ior
A handshake and a friendly smile are common when meeting someone for the first time.
Brazilians are generally warm and may stand closer during conversations than what you might be used to.
Wait for the host to invite you to eat and do not start until everyone is served.

Tipping in Andradina
Ensure a smooth experience
It is customary to leave a tip of around 10% in restaurants, but it is not mandatory.
Credit cards are widely accepted, but it's advisable to carry cash for small purchases and at markets.
